> > I actually do not know how many targets will be compiled (we have more
> than
> > 10k targets in a Makefile). So, is there a straightforward way to know
> that
> > only a single code file is changed and it will be an incremental build
> and
> > not a full build ?
>
> It sounds like make has to walk all the rules and determine whether all
> non-PHONY targets required updating. If so, it was a complete build.
>
> If even one real target is skipped because it is up-to-date, it's
> an incremental build.
